2011 UZS to DKK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2011

During 2011, the UZS to DKK ex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on January 10, valuing the pair at 0.0035.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on May 3, dropping to 0.0029.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.0006 DKK.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 0.0034 to the December average rate of 0.0031, the exchange rate registered a net change of -6.57% (reflecting a weakening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2011 high of 0.0035 was down 10.81% compared to the 2010 peak of 0.0039,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

Monthly Breakdown

Statistical summary for each calendar month.

Month High Low Average
January 0.0035 0.0033 0.0034
February 0.0033 0.0032 0.0033
March 0.0032 0.0031 0.0032
April 0.0031 0.0030 0.0030
May 0.0031 0.0029 0.0030
June 0.0031 0.0030 0.0030
July 0.0031 0.0030 0.0030
August 0.0030 0.0029 0.0030
September 0.0032 0.0030 0.0031
October 0.0032 0.0030 0.0031
November 0.0031 0.0030 0.0031
December 0.0032 0.0031 0.0031
